Transaction 5003ee68a1a13104059a26ebe17b574eeaf02ca87a536ecbd0cc785bfd8d4735
1 Input
1 Output
-
5003ee68a1a13104059a26ebe17b574eeaf02ca87a536ecbd0cc785bfd8d4735:0
- value
- 14675039
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69fe7ff98e8f0931329b50c876236a17c1515678 OP_EQUAL
- address
- MHZc4Y1rjt7eRbmKWE9bzibcoTpXdFF49H